The news regarding South Korean Government Seizing Crypto Holdings of Tax Evaders Worth $22 Million is all over twitter lately and not one crypto media outlet has lost the opportunity of talking it.

It looks like the Seoul government has seized crypto holdings from 676 individuals that are supposedly tax evaders. $22 million worth of crypto has gotten in the hands of the governments and 118 of them paid the government 1.26 billion Korean won (more than $11.2 million) of their dues. Money doesn't have intrinsic value. It has the value of the size of the market at this time. When you print more than the size of the market, the numerical value of things go up. That's called inflation and it's rampant. The US prints with low consequences (there IS inflation, it's just covered) because it's the currency used for global commerce.
In countries where the currency is just local, and the governments print more than the country produces, inflation is rampant, like it's happening right now in Argentina.

Infrastructure and public services are two good reasons for taxes -- how do you propose, given that there is no profit motive for maintaining those things, that they be funded WITHOUT government, and thus, taxes? Paved roads with sidewalks, bridges, highways, and the lights that manage traffic on all of those -- tax dollars at work. All the workers that maintain those things -- tax dollars at work. Corruption in government? Of course. It's a shame. We need to vote a bunch of people out of office in both major parties.

And yet, the street outside my home, with the good pavement and sidewalks, and the county and state parks where thousands and thousands get relief from the stress of life, and the medical care for millions of people who are priced out of the private market, and the public schools for millions of children -- all tax dollars at work, without which society would collapse because even the pretense of my home country offering opportunity for all would collapse. There would be no police officers or EMTs or National Guard or fire fighters to deal with that collapse either without tax dollars -- we LITERALLY would be discussing the end of civil society. Personally, I prefer civil society ... so I'm going to go ahead and pay my taxes, and then head out to the park I paid to have there...
